How to set up a dataseries of volume of first 5 minutes ?
I am wondering if I can setup a dataseries of the volume traded in first 5 minutes everyday such that I can compare those volumes to see, say, if today first 5 minutes volume is bigger than the average volume traded of previous 5 days?Last edited by randomwalker; 05-29-2010, 11:33 PM.Tags: None
-
randomwalker, you could set a dataseries for exmaple for the first bar on the 5 minute chart only and then average those datapoints, however I think it would be easier to just store the first 5 min bar volume from the prior days in a double value and then compare as needed in your code.BertrandNinjaTrader Customer Service
-
I tried to code as follows(suppose I have already setup dataseries fbv):
if (Bars.BarsSinceSession == 0){fbv.Set(Volume[0]);}
else {fbv.Set(0);}
However, by coding like above, I think I get dataseries of Volume[0],0,0,....0. Is there any way to only store the first 5 minutes volume for everyday?
